Niki Roach

Director at Uros Consulting

Play to your strengths, don’t try and do the job like your colleagues who are likely to be men. Your experience and approach is what makes you unique. On a more practical note, work hard and get a good numerate degree along with experience of making decisions without all of the data.

What do I do?

"I am the Director of my own consultancy. I work with other organisations to help them achieve their goals. This involves problem solving and helping them better understand what’s stopping them achieving better performance. I also work with companies to develop business relationships to enable them to sell products to other companies. This can be exciting and adrenaline fuelled, particularly when something needs doing urgently. I enjoy supporting my teams and helping others to develop. Now I’m self-employed there’s no specific progression but I’m also a Trustee of a charity in order to develop skills that are more difficult to obtain in a small business. If you like visiting sewage works then this is the job for you! Seriously though, getting to understand how the infrastructure of our towns and cities works is fascinating and I’ve had some brilliant site visits."

How did I get here?

"I was inspired by the TV programme Blue Peter! I had The Green Book when I was younger which increased my interested in the environment. I got a place on a Graduate scheme with a major UK water company because I wanted a good grounding in the sector and enjoyed the variety that a large company provided. Once I had the experience, I wanted the flexibility of working for myself and after a career break to travel, I set up my own business."

My typical day

"My days are really varied, but often include client meetings, travel, working from home or presenting at a conference, lots of problem solving and helping others see the bigger picture."
